The article is devoted to labour productivity increase as one of ways in a series of measures to go out of financial crisis for Russia and to achieve economic growth. The similar approach is the result of the derivation of the analytical dependency where the change on the profitability of the enterprise from labour productivity is shown. The Principal position of the author is that Labor Remuneration of employees directly connected to the release goods or rendering services is proportional to labour productivity growth, and it provides the growth of production efficiency.
